Just when we thought the Downton Abbey saga had finished tugging at our heartstrings, the dramatic final scene in *The Grand Finale* delivers one last emotional punch. Currently lighting up theaters across the country, this third installment wraps up with a stunningly poignant moment where the beloved characters—some of whom we’ve lost—gather for a final, unforgettable dance.
Director Simon Curtis takes us on a nostalgic journey with archival footage, reintroducing younger versions of fan-favorites from Season 1 as they come together for a splendid upstairs-downstairs celebration. The atmosphere shifts from joyful to bittersweet as we catch glimpses of the late, beloved Maggie Smith, returning as the iconic Dowager Countess, followed closely by the ethereal presence of Jessica Brown Findlay as the tragic Lady Sybil, who left us too soon.
Julian Fellowes, the mastermind behind the series, shared his thoughts on this evocative finale. "We aimed to remind viewers of their love for the characters and what they brought to the story," he explains. There was some concern about whether newer fans would appreciate the nostalgia. However, Fellowes reassures us that it’s not about recognition; it's about acknowledging how these characters shaped each other's lives.
But wait! The story doesn't quite close the book on *Downton Abbey*. Fellowes clarifies that while this may seem like the end, he hasn't ruled out a future return to the beloved estate. "I’m not saying we won't revisit Downton; it’s just unlikely to be with the same beloved cast and era. This ensemble is irreplaceable," he reveals.
